    Omg slippery slope

    Ok, lightning struck the house and rocked the world, I got one PC going ok, and I got my router replaced. Well I was replacing the network card in the other PC and after I worked with it, it won't boot. I thought power supply at first because the fans didn't spin up but lights on the MB did turn on, so now I am stumped. I hope it is not the MB but I don't know. Before I replaced the network card the PC booted fine, posted and ran tip top, except everything was Blue. It was like the video card was not drawing red or green. I swapped monitors and confirmed that that was not the problem, and I have not replaced the video card yet.

    Any suggestions?

    I had this problem with my mobo a while back. The lights turn on, but when you press the power button the fans flinched a lil, but didn't go on. It turned out to be the power supply.

    if lighting strikes it depends on the amps volts ect it can jump over surge protectors and if it goes into the network there is a 25% give or take of it taking out the mb cpu ect... check the mother board's capacitors and make sure one or more isn't bulging or blown out and smell for that burn smell of a short if its ok look at the cpu get another mb and try the cpu in there if it works then its the viedo card or the mother board do the same with the video card if you rout out all the culprates the lighting could have wiped out Dos/bios or the north and south bridges depending on what processor you have.
